*: fix shellcheck warnings

Fixes scripts and removes shellcheck warning suppressions.

* regexp warnings
* use ./*glob* so names don't become options
* use $(..) instead of legacy `..`
* read with -r to avoid mangling backslashes
* double quote to prevent globbing and word splitting
